- The distance between Nantes, France and San Antonio, Argentina is approximately 11,611 km or 7,215 mi.
- To reach Nantes in this distance one would set out from San Antonio bearing 38.9° or NE and follow the great circles arc to approach Nantes bearing 44.4° or NE .
- Nantes has a marine west coast climate (Cfb) whereas San Antonio has a mid-latitude cool steppe climate (BSk).
- Nantes is in or near the cool temperate moist forest biome whereas San Antonio is in or near the warm temperate desert scrub biome.
- The mean annual temperature is 4.1 °C (7.4°F) cooler.
- Average monthly temperatures vary by 0.3 °C (0.5°F) less in Nantes. The continentality subtype is truly oceanic for both.
- Total annual precipitation averages 540.5 mm (21.3 in) more which is equivalent to 540.5 l/m² (13.27 US gal/ft²) or 5,405,000 l/ha (577,830 US gal/ac) more. About 3 1/6 as much.
- The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 5.6° lower in Nantes than in San Antonio.
- Relative humidity levels are 25.5% higher.
- The mean dew point temperature is 2°C (3.6°F) higher.
